1991 SCMR 351

Syed AFZAL HUSSAIN SHAH vs QANITA KHATOON

Citation1991 SCMR 351
CourtSupreme Court of Pakistan
Case No.Civil Petition for Leave to Appeal No. 884 of 1985 Civil Revision No. 696 of
Date1989-06-14
Judge(s)Muhammad Afzal Zullah, Syed Usman Ali Shah
ResultLeave refused

ORDER

1. MUHAMMAD AFZAL ZULLAH, J.---Leave to appeal has been sought by the defendant in a money suit; against the dismissal by the High Court of his Civil Revision on the finding that there being no misreading or non-reading of evidence no justification was made out for exercise of revisional jurisdiction.

2. The petitioner has lost throughout and now the decree for recovery of Rs.7,262.79 stands affirmed also by the High Court. The only argument after the rejection of the petitioner's pleas on merits pressed by his learned counsel before us relates to the plea of limitation.

3. The liability to pay the amount has been established against the petitioner. After hearing the learned counsel on the point of limitation we do not consider it a fit case for exercise of the discretionary jurisdiction of the Supreme Court in granting leave to appeal in his favour. The same, accordingly, is refused.
